March 17, 200619 yr Hello... I am new to Filemaker (ver 8) but have experience with Access and SQL, and I just can't figure it out in Filemaker. I have 2 tables related by Deptid. 1 table is people and 1 table is a list of depts, location, manager etc. I would like to create a layout (as a data entry form) to add a person (or edit) and their dept (and then the location, manager etc would display). I only want the related fields (ie location, manager etc) to display and not be editable. IE - I input John Doe and dept is HR. the HR office and HR manager should appear and cannot be changed. I don't know if I need a portal (I have read that portals are for multiple rows of records). Any assistance to this newbie to FM8 would be greatly appreciated.

March 21, 200619 yr Since the People is the MANY side of the relationship, you can place your Department fields directly on the People layout. You can use regular fields (with Allow Entry in Browse unchecked) OR just place merge fields of them.
